EU imposes anti-dumping duties on US biodiesel

Bowing to pressure from the European Biodiesel Board (EBB), the EU on 13 March imposed temporary anti-dumping and countervailing duties - ranging from -26 to -41 per 100 kilogrammes - on imports of US biodiesel. Export cess on basmati abolished

Prabha Jagannathan NEW DELHI A MINISTERIAL panel has decided to abolish export cess on basmati rice and reduce the floor price for overseas sales of the staple amid forecasts of good harvest. The government had imposed a cess of Rs 8,000/tonne in April 2008 on basmati exports to boost domestic …
